Tri-City Herald

The Tri-City Herald is a daily newspaper based in Kennewick, Washington, United States.

Owned by The McClatchy Company, the newspaper serves southeastern Washington state, including the three cities of Kennewick, Pasco and Richland (which are collectively known as the Tri-Cities).

It is the only major English-language newspaper in Washington east of Yakima and south of Spokane, and includes local and national news, opinion columns, sports information, movie listings and comic strips among other features.

In 1950, striking workers of the Herald launched a morning competitor, Columbia Basin News, in Pasco.
